Re: Powell OUT : Wed Jul 13, 2022 6:32 pm  
Opinions on Powell sit across a spectrum. This thread is a good place to put forward those opinions for a balanced argument, but for the first time in a while on this forum, it's turned to some petty in-fighting and name calling. At the end of the day we're all on the same side and want the club to succeed. I'm in the Powell-rebuild camp, even though I'm certain he's made a few little mistakes along the way. I'm not naive and I'm not 100% sure we'll be better off with him than anyone else, but I'm surprisingly positive about what lies ahead. He's got a record of improving clubs and players, he's somewhat radically changing how things are done behind the scenes, and he coaches exciting rugby.

I've no idea why, but it feels like it will come good. Or maybe it's just the extreme heat or something. Either way, if anyone feels like an angry rant against a fellow poster, take time out and go pull the legs off a Widnes fan (for those forum members under 40 - Widnes were a RL team from Liverpool who had a couple of good years in the 80s).
